World Supercross returns to Europe in December
The 2025 FIM World Supercross Championship (WSX) calendar has been revised following the withdrawal of Kuala Lumpur’s Stadium Merdeka because the season opener, with Sweden stepping in to take care of a full five-round, five-continent schedule.
The addition of Stockholm strengthens the collection’ world attain, making certain WSX continues its growth throughout new markets. The revised calendar now begins in Buenos Aires, Argentina, on 8 November, earlier than heading to Vancouver, the Gold Coast, Stockholm, and Cape City for the season finale.
The up to date 2025 WSX calendar is as follows:
Spherical 1 – Buenos Aires, Argentina: 8 November
Spherical 2 – Vancouver, Canada: 15 November
Spherical 3 – Gold Coast, Australia: 29 November
Spherical 4 – Stockholm, Sweden: 6 December
Spherical 5 – Cape City, South Africa: 13 December
Tom Burwell – World Supercross CEO
“We’re thrilled to substantiate that our season will head again to Europe, and specifically to Sweden, a rustic with a ardour for two-wheeled motorsport. The Swedish GP will probably be a incredible addition to the Championship and the perfect setting for the penultimate spherical. We have been let down at this late stage by the Stadium Merdeka, regardless of the numerous time, funding, and dedication that went into bringing world-class supercross to Malaysia for the very first time. Because of the relentless work of our group and the backing of our companions, we’ve turned disappointment into momentum. Sweden completes a five-round Championship throughout 5 continents in 2025, forward of what’s shaping as much as be our greatest season but.”
The brand new schedule retains WSX on 5 continents. It confirms the collection’ dedication to establishing a really world Supercross championship, with returning venues and a recent cease in Scandinavia rounding out the 2025 season.

Twisted Tea Suzuki signal Jason Anderson
Twisted Tea Suzuki has confirmed the signing of 2018 AMA Supercross Champion Jason Anderson, who will race the Suzuki RM-Z450 within the 2025 and 2026 World Supercross seasons and the 2026 SuperMotocross Championship.
It marks a homecoming for the 31-year-old American, whose profession started on Suzuki equipment as a part of the model’s novice improvement program within the mid-2000s. Anderson claimed 5 Loretta Lynn’s Novice titles and the 2010 Nicky Hayden AMA Horizon Award earlier than turning professional with Rockstar Suzuki in 2011. His first skilled podium got here a yr later in Salt Lake Metropolis, adopted by his maiden victory on the identical venue in 2013.
Jason Anderson
Recognized universally as El Hombre, Anderson went on to seize the 2014 250SX West title and the 2018 AMA 450SX Championship, amassing greater than 16 premier-class wins alongside the way in which.
Jason Anderson
“Tremendous excited to be again on yellow. My first expertise with manufacturing facility help I ever had was from Suzuki in 2003, so 23 years later it’s fairly cool to be with them on the high degree of the game!”
Anderson’s signing reunites him with the producer the place his skilled journey started and strengthens Suzuki’s high-profile Supercross line-up alongside Ken Roczen, giving the model a potent 1-2 mixture for 2026.
Anderson will make his first aggressive look in Suzuki colors on the Buenos Aires World Supercross opener on 8 November, earlier than turning his consideration to SuperMotocross in 2026.

Fricke and Doyle confirmed as everlasting 2026 SpeedwayGP wildcards
Three of the game’s greatest names — Jason Doyle, Max Fricke, and Tai Woffinden — have been confirmed as everlasting riders for the 2026 FIM Speedway Grand Prix World Championship, finishing a 15-rider subject stacked with world champions and rising stars.
Former world champion Jason Doyle extends his Speedway GP profession right into a twelfth consecutive season, simply days after serving to Australia declare the 2025 FIM Speedway of Nations crown in Poland. Regardless of harm setbacks in current seasons, together with a torn rotator cuff and hip issues that curtailed elements of his 2024 and 2025 campaigns, Doyle stays a confirmed race winner and key determine within the championship combine.
He’ll be joined by fellow Aussie Max Fricke, a three-time Australian champion and 2022 Speedway of Nations gold medallist, who narrowly missed out on computerized qualification after ending eighth within the 2025 standings. Fricke reached seven of ten last-chance qualifiers this yr and matched his career-best general end, securing his return by way of the SGP Fee’s picks.
Finishing the trio of wildcards is Tai Woffinden, Nice Britain’s most profitable speedway rider with three world titles. The 34-year-old will return to the full-time GP roster trying so as to add to his 22 profession GP wins and lead the British cost alongside compatriots Dan Bewley and Robert Lambert, each computerized qualifiers.
2026 SpeedwayGP riders confirmed
They be a part of a 2026 line-up led by six-time world champion Bartosz Zmarzlik, who claimed his newest title after a season-long combat with Brady Kurtz, the Australian taking 5 straight GP wins and falling only one level in need of gold. Kurtz and fellow Australian Jack Holder each return as computerized qualifiers after ending second and fifth, respectively.
Different confirmed riders embrace Fredrik Lindgren (Sweden), Andzejs Lebedevs (Latvia), and Poland’s returning Patryk Dudek, who reclaims his GP place after profitable each the 2025 Speedway European Championship and Polish nationwide title.
Qualifiers from the FIM SGP Problem, Dominik Kubera, Kacper Woryna, Leon Madsen, and Michael Jepsen Jensen, spherical out the grid.
On the reserve record, Ukraine’s new Below-21 World Champion Nazar Parnitskyi leads the substitutes, adopted by Anders Thomsen (Denmark), Jan Kvech (Czech Republic), Kai Huckenbeck (Germany), and Mathias Pollestad (Norway).
The complete 2026 FIM Speedway GP calendar is about to be introduced within the coming weeks.

2025 FIM Speedway of Nations Wrap – Australia triumphant
Staff Australia delivered a commanding efficiency to seize its second FIM Speedway of Nations (SON) crown in 4 years, defeating host nation Poland in an exhilarating closing on the MotoArena in Torun.
The decisive race went completely to plan for the Aussies, as Brady Kurtz and Jack Holder produced a flawless 1-2 end over Polish stars Bartosz Zmarzlik and Patryk Dudek to seal the title. Their victory provides to Australia’s 2022 triumph and cements the nation’s rising legacy in world group speedway.
After a tentative opening warmth, the Australian duo discovered their rhythm and swept to most factors in each subsequent race, combining velocity, precision, and excellent teamwork to dominate the night time. Within the closing, the tried-and-tested formation paid off as soon as once more, Holder hugging the within whereas Kurtz blasted across the outer line to safe the gold in emphatic trend.
Staff supervisor Mark Lemon opted to not subject reserve rider Jason Doyle, the 2017 Speedway GP World Champion, as Kurtz and Holder carried the inexperienced and gold to glory on their very own.
Denmark, narrowly crushed by Poland within the semi-final playoff, accomplished the rostrum in third place, adopted by Sweden, defending champion Nice Britain, Latvia, and the Czech Republic.
Holder, a member of Australia’s 2022 profitable squad, was ecstatic to as soon as once more stand atop the world stage.
“We’ve been coaching for this since we have been 9 years outdated,” Holder stated. “Now we’re world champions once more and I couldn’t be prouder.”

Provisional 2026 Hertz FIM Trial World Championship calendar
The provisional calendar for the 2026 Hertz FIM Trial World Championship has been launched, comprising seven scheduled rounds and 13 days of points-scoring competitors with the collection returning to the Netherlands for the primary time since 2019, revisiting an Italian venue final utilized in 1992 and stopping off at an all-new venue in Nice Britain.
In a repeat of 2024, the championship will get below method with the TrialGP of Japan that will probably be staged on the hugely-popular Mobility Resort Motegi on 15-17 Could earlier than the motion heads to Europe with spherical two scheduled for 12-14 June at Sant Julià de Lòria in Andorra.
The next weekend sees the TrialGP of Italy at Camerino – a venue that was final utilized in 1992 when the late Diego Bosis claimed an extremely widespread house victory forward of Finnish champion-elect Tommi Ahvala – earlier than the motion resumes 5 weeks in a while 24-26 July with the TrialGB of Nice Britain at Trac Mon Circuit, an thrilling new venue on Anglesey, an island mendacity off the coast of north Wales.
Following the normal summer season break, spherical 5 takes place on 29-30 August with a single day of points-scoring competitors at Cahors for the TrialGP of France and the collection then heads north for the TrialGP of the Netherlands – again on the calendar for the primary time since 2019 – at Zelhem on 4-6 September.
The championship will conclude on 18-20 September with the TrialGP of Spain at Pobladura de las Regueras, a venue final used for the FIM Trial des Nations in 2024.
Trial2 opponents will as soon as once more be a part of TrialGP riders in any respect seven rounds. TrialGP Girls opponents will solely sit out France and the Netherlands and Trial3 riders will miss simply Japan and Spain. The Trial2 Girls title will probably be determined in Italy, Nice Britain and Spain.
The 2026 FIM Trial des Nations will happen on 26-27 September at Arteixo in Spain, scene of the opening spherical of the 2023 Hertz FIM Trial World Championship.
A date and venue for the FIM Trial Classic Trophy and FIM Trial Classic Bike Trophy remains to be awaiting affirmation.

Provisional 2026 FIM Motocross World Championship Calendar
FIM and Infront Moto Racing have introduced the provisional 2026 FIM Motocross World Championship Calendar, that includes 20 rounds throughout a number of the sport’s most iconic and difficult venues. The season will conclude with the distinguished Monster Vitality FIM Motocross of Nations in Ernée, France, on 4 October 2026.
MXGP returns in 2026 with a 20-round collection adopted by MXoN
The 2026 season will start on 22 February with a yet-to-be-announced venue earlier than heading to Argentina on 8 March, on a location to be introduced quickly for the now conventional South American spherical. Two weeks later, MXGP returns to Spain and this time at Almonte within the scorching Andalusian area on 22 March for the primary European outing, adopted instantly by Switzerland in Frauenfeld on 29 March, the primary back-to-back races of the yr.
Then there will probably be a robust spring block in Europe. April will see the Italian double-header with Riola Sardo (Sardegna) on 12 April and Pietramurata (Trentino) on 19 April, each agency and common fixtures within the early MXGP calendar.
The championship resumes after a two-week break in Nice Britain on 10 Could at a venue to be introduced shortly, earlier than an intense triple-header unfolds:
France (Lacapelle Marival) on 24 Could
Germany (Teutschenthal) on 31 Could
Latvia (Kegums) on 7 June
Then summer season warmth will begin to come because the collection travels again to Italy, with Montevarchi internet hosting the MXGP of Italy on 21 June, adopted by one other back-to-back pairing with Portugal (Águeda) on 28 June.
After a brief pause, July resumes with a scorching triple header, comprising of a TBA occasion on 19 July, earlier than transferring straight to Czech Republic (Loket) on 26 July. The back-to-back- flows instantly into Flanders (Lommel) on 2 August, making a high-intensity triple-header.
In August, the motion heads north with Sweden (Uddevalla) on 16 August and the Netherlands (Arnhem) on 23 August, one other back-to-back weekend to shut the European summer season.
The decisive abroad part of the championship begins the grand finale in September with a triple-header:
Turkiye (Afyonkarahisar) on 6 September
China (Shanghai) on 13 September
Australia (Darwin) on 20 September
This difficult run of three consecutive abroad races will deliver the 2026 season to a spectacular shut.

Australia retain FIM Motocross of Nations crown MXoN Quotes
Staff Australia have retained the Monster Vitality FIM Motocross of Nations (MXoN) crown after a commanding show at Ironman Raceway in Indiana, the Lawrence brothers delivering three race wins between them to safe a second straight Chamberlain Trophy for the inexperienced and gold.
With temperatures hovering for the 78th version of the occasion, an enormous American crowd witnessed one other defining day in Australian motocross historical past as Jett and Hunter Lawrence gained all three motos outright, backed by a gritty effort from Kyle Webster in MX2.
Australia’s mixed whole of 19 factors left them effectively away from a tense battle for second between Staff USA and Staff France, each ending on 33 factors, with the host nation taking the runner-up spot on countback due to Eli Tomac’s second place within the closing moto. Belgium completed fourth and Slovenia fifth after a constant displaying from Jan Pancar.
MXoN 2025
Race One MXGP and MX2
The day started with Jett Lawrence resuming his dominant kind from Saturday’s qualifying, however it was Lucas Coenen (Belgium) who grabbed the Fox Holeshot forward of Jett and Tim Gajser. The opening laps have been chaotic, with Ken Roczen (Germany) crashing early and teammate Simon Längenfelder additionally compelled out in a first-turn pile-up.
By lap two, Jett swept previous Coenen on the Godzilla Hill part to take management and was by no means headed, the Australian pulling clear to win by seven seconds. Gajser held third behind Coenen, whereas Tomac pushed laborious to shut inside two seconds of a podium end.
Romain Febvre (France) recovered from a small crash to complete fifth, forward of Ruben Fernandez, Isak Gifting, and Kay de Wolf — the Dutchman as soon as once more the highest MX2 finisher.
Webster, who went down within the first nook, charged via from the again to complete fifteenth, making certain Australia sat third general after the opening race, narrowly behind the USA and France.
